Selecting and Preparing Your Mushrooms
Choosing the right mushrooms can make your sautéed greens with mushrooms stand out. Mushrooms add unique textures and rich flavors that pair well with kale.
There are many mushroom types to choose from for your morning sauté. Here are some favorites:
- Cremini mushrooms: Mild and slightly nutty, perfect for beginners
- Shiitake mushrooms: Strong, earthy taste with a meaty feel
- Wild mushroom mix: Offers a mix of complex flavors
- Oyster mushrooms: Soft and delicate, cooks quickly
Preparing mushrooms is key. Clean them with a damp paper towel, not under running water. This keeps them from getting too wet and ensures they cook well.
When you slice mushrooms, try to make them all the same size. This helps them cook evenly. Thin slices will also make them golden brown and flavorful in your breakfast sauté.
Pro tip: To get a nice caramelized crust, don’t overcrowd the pan. Cook in batches if you need to. This way, your mushrooms will get that crispy texture that makes the dish so good.

Storage and Reheating Guidelines

Keeping your quick kale breakfast fresh is easy. Just follow the right storage tips. This way, you can enjoy your savory breakfast ideas all week long with little effort.
Refrigeration Best Practices
First, let your kale and mushroom sauté cool down completely. Then, put it in an airtight container. This keeps it fresh and stops bacteria from growing.
- Store in refrigerator within 2 hours of cooking
- Use a sealed glass or plastic container
- Keep refrigerated for up to 3-4 days
Reheating Techniques
Bring your leftover quick kale breakfast back to life with these easy steps:
Reheating Method | Instructions | Cooking Time |
---|---|---|
Stovetop | Use medium-low heat, stir occasionally | 3-4 minutes |
Microwave | Cover and heat in 30-second intervals | 1-2 minutes |
Pro tip: Add a splash of water or broth to prevent drying out when reheating your savory breakfast ideas.

How To Make Kale and Mushroom Breakfast Sauté: A Nutrient-Rich Morning Meal
Ingredients
- 1 tablespoon olive oil or ghee
- 1 clove garlic minced
- 1/2 small onion thinly sliced
- 1 cup mushrooms sliced (cremini, button, or shiitake)
- 3 cups kale stems removed and chopped
- Salt & pepper to taste
- Pinch of red pepper flakes optional
- 2 eggs fried or poached, optional for topping
- Shredded Parmesan or feta optional for garnish
Instructions
- Sauté Aromatics
-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ium heat.
- Add garlic and onion; cook for 2–3 minutes until fragrant and softened.
- Cook Mushrooms
- Add mushrooms to the pan. Sauté until browned and tender, about 4–5 minutes.
- Add Kale
- Stir in chopped kale. Cook for 2–3 minutes, stirring, until wilted but still bright green.
- Season with salt, pepper, and red pepper flakes (if using).
- Optional Eggs
- In a separate pan, cook eggs to your liking (fried or poached).
- Serve sauté topped with eggs and cheese, if desired.
